Rename PID file

Add symlinks back to ssh in RPM spec file
This commit is contained in:
Damien Miller 1999-10-28 14:34:49 +10:00
parent 92986dd9ba
commit 29d685212f
2 changed files with 20 additions and 2 deletions

View File

@ -64,6 +64,16 @@ install -m644 openssh-agent.1 $RPM_BUILD_ROOT/usr/man/man1
install -m644 openssh-add.1 $RPM_BUILD_ROOT/usr/man/man1 install -m644 openssh-add.1 $RPM_BUILD_ROOT/usr/man/man1
install -m644 openssh-keygen.1 $RPM_BUILD_ROOT/usr/man/man1 install -m644 openssh-keygen.1 $RPM_BUILD_ROOT/usr/man/man1
# Install compatibility symlinks
cd $RPM_BUILD_ROOT/usr/sbin
ln -s opensshd sshd
cd $RPM_BUILD_ROOT/usr/bin
ln -s openssh ssh
ln -s openscp scp
ln -s openssh-agent ssh-agent
ln -s openssh-add ssh-add
ln -s openssh-keygen ssh-keygen
%clean %clean
rm -rf $RPM_BUILD_ROOT rm -rf $RPM_BUILD_ROOT
@ -95,6 +105,14 @@ fi
%attr(0755,root,root) /usr/bin/openssh-add %attr(0755,root,root) /usr/bin/openssh-add
%attr(0755,root,root) /usr/bin/openscp %attr(0755,root,root) /usr/bin/openscp
# Symlinks
%attr(0755,root,root) /usr/sbin/sshd
%attr(0755,root,root) /usr/bin/ssh
%attr(0755,root,root) /usr/bin/ssh-agent
%attr(0755,root,root) /usr/bin/ssh-keygen
%attr(0755,root,root) /usr/bin/ssh-add
%attr(0755,root,root) /usr/bin/scp
%attr(0755,root,root) /usr/man/man8/opensshd.8 %attr(0755,root,root) /usr/man/man8/opensshd.8
%attr(0755,root,root) /usr/man/man1/openssh.1 %attr(0755,root,root) /usr/man/man1/openssh.1
%attr(0755,root,root) /usr/man/man1/openssh-agent.1 %attr(0755,root,root) /usr/man/man1/openssh-agent.1

4
ssh.h
View File

@ -13,7 +13,7 @@ Generic header file for ssh.
*/ */
/* RCSID("$Id: ssh.h,v 1.2 1999/10/28 03:25:17 damien Exp $"); */ /* RCSID("$Id: ssh.h,v 1.3 1999/10/28 04:34:49 damien Exp $"); */
#ifndef SSH_H #ifndef SSH_H
#define SSH_H #define SSH_H
@ -89,7 +89,7 @@ only by root, whereas ssh_config should be world-readable. */
/* The process id of the daemon listening for connections is saved /* The process id of the daemon listening for connections is saved
here to make it easier to kill the correct daemon when necessary. */ here to make it easier to kill the correct daemon when necessary. */
#define SSH_DAEMON_PID_FILE PIDDIR "/sshd.pid" #define SSH_DAEMON_PID_FILE PIDDIR "/opensshd.pid"
/* The directory in user\'s home directory in which the files reside. /* The directory in user\'s home directory in which the files reside.
The directory should be world-readable (though not all files are). */ The directory should be world-readable (though not all files are). */